|  | C++ SDK Documentation
    24.2.0
    | 
This is the complete list of members for Vertica::UDFileSystem, including all inherited members.
| canonicalizePath(const std::string &path)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| close(UDFileOperator *udfo)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| copy(const char *srcpath, const char *dstpath)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| copyFrom(const std::string &srcpath, const std::string &destpath, size_t bufsize, size_t srcsize=INVALID_UINT64)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| deleteSnapshot(const std::string &snapshot_handle)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| getDescription()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| getDisplayName()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| getEncodedURI(const char *path)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| getFanoutDirectory(uint64_t id)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| getSlowRequestThreshold()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| getStats()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| getURIEncodedStr(const char *str)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| isFanoutDirectory(const std::string &fileName)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| link(const char *oldpath, const char *newpath)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| listFiles(const char *path, std::vector< std::string > &result)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| listStat(const char *dir, std::vector< NameStatPair > &result)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| mkdirs(const char *path, mode_t mode)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| open() const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| open(const char *path, int flags, mode_t mode, const OpenOptions &options=OpenOptions())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| readBufferSizeHint()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| remove(const char *path)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| rename(const char *oldpath, const char *newpath)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| restoreSnapshot(const std::string &snapshot_handle, const std::string &path)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| rmdir(const char *path)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| rmdirRecursive(const char *path)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| setTempPath(const std::string &path) (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| snapshotDirectory(const std::string &path, std::string &snapshot_handle)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| stat(const char *path, struct ::stat *buf)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| statvfs(const char *path, struct ::statvfs *buf) const =0 (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| pure virtual | 
| supportsAtomicReplacement()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| supportsBatchRemove()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| supportsDirectories()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| supportsDirectorySnapshots() const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| symlink(const char *oldpath, const char *newpath)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| truncate(const char *path, off_t length)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| virtual | 
| UDFileSystem() (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inline | 
| UDFS_DEFAULT_READ_SIZE_HINT (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| static | 
| unmount() (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| validatePath(const std::string &path) const (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ual | 
| ~UDFileSystem() (defined in Vertica::UDFileSystem) | Vertica::UDFileSystem | inlinevirtual |